Clinica Sierra Vista is one of the largest Federally Qualified Health Centers in California and the nation, having earned the trust of its patients, partners and the communities it serves over a 47-year history distinguished by rapid growth and innovation, exceptional primary-care physicians, and a reputation for treating the most vulnerable residents with respect and compassion.

Clinica Sierra Vista, accredited by the rigorous Joint Commission, serves patients at 31 health centers in Fresno and Kern counties. Our services include Pediatric Care, Adult Care, Dental Care, Behavioral Health, Case Management, Prenatal & Women’s Health, Substance Abuse Treatment, HIV/AIDS testing and treatment, Health Education, Outreach and WIC services. We partner with local governments, social services departments, businesses and nonprofit leaders to address the full range of needs for our patients.
